Industrial Bearing Landscape in Cambodia

Analyzing the impact of tropical climates and infrastructure growth on component longevity.

Cambodia's industrial sector is currently characterized by a rapid transition toward garment manufacturing and agri-processing. However, the high humidity and temperature fluctuations inherent to the region place extreme stress on conventional steel bearings, leading to accelerated oxidation and premature failure of grooved ball bearing units in standard machinery.

The rise of the Special Economic Zones (SEZs) has increased the demand for high-capacity equipment. We see a growing shift toward heavy duty spherical bearing applications in mining and heavy construction projects near the Mekong basin, where misalignment and heavy radial loads are common operational challenges.

Furthermore, the energy sector's expansion into hydropower and vertical pumping systems has highlighted a critical need for specialized vertical motor bearings that can withstand axial thrust and prevent leakage in harsh environmental conditions.

Market Development History

In the early 2000s, the Cambodian market relied primarily on low-cost, general-purpose steel bearings. These components often lacked the precision required for high-speed operation, resulting in high maintenance costs for early textile mills.

Between 2010 and 2020, there was a noticeable shift toward specialized alloys. The introduction of hybrid ceramics and improved sealing technologies reduced downtime, as industries began adopting ceramic sleeve bearings for chemical-resistant and high-wear applications.

Entering the 2020s, the focus has shifted to "extreme environment" engineering. The integration of non-oxide ceramics, specifically silicon nitride, has revolutionized high-precision tooling and electric motor efficiency across the region.

Common Industrial Bearing Questions in Cambodia

Technical guidance for optimizing bearing life in tropical environments.

How to prevent corrosion in grooved ball bearing units in humid areas?

Using specialized seals and corrosion-resistant coatings or upgrading to hybrid ceramic balls can significantly prevent oxidation in high-humidity environments like Cambodia.

What are the advantages of silicon nitride ball bearings over steel?

Silicon nitride offers lower density, higher hardness, and superior thermal stability, making them ideal for high-speed applications and reducing centrifugal forces.

When should I choose a heavy duty spherical bearing for my machinery?

These are recommended for applications involving heavy radial loads and where shaft misalignment is likely, such as in mining conveyors or large industrial fans.

How do vertical motor bearings handle axial thrust differently?

They are specifically engineered to support the weight of the rotor and the downward thrust of the fluid, preventing wear on the motor's internal housing.

Are ceramic sleeve bearings suitable for chemical processing?

Yes, because ceramics are chemically inert, they are highly resistant to acids and bases, making them far superior to metal sleeves in chemical environments.

How often should bearings be lubricated in tropical industrial zones?

Due to high temperatures and dust, we recommend a more frequent lubrication schedule using high-viscosity synthetic greases to maintain a protective film.
